Output d59fe9ddaa2b7fe5e65352118837022482e841d0f698c09457116312122bd191:69

value
339487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c9f9c86a463614a9e40034f16a86c12ba8b154 OP_EQUAL
address
32DdG2CnmDWCW31jXbkCoY33i7V6uf5tck
transaction
d59fe9ddaa2b7fe5e65352118837022482e841d0f698c09457116312122bd191